Hello everyone, I've been looking some infos in Inet, but I didnt really find what I was looking for. I am working with a XC164CS32F, for my project I need various timers. Quick explanation: Timer0 : timer for my logical automat (set at 100ms) Timer1 : timer for picking values from a couple of sensors (set at 50 ms). Timer7 : I would like to generate a simple PWM signal, but as nothing was occuring, Im just increasing a dummy global variable (I will try to do the PWM on my own after being sure that the timer7 is really working!).
As far as I have debugged (and it seems to work pretty good), timer0 and 1 work perfectly. Timer7 just do not generate any interruption. My first guess was that the vector address was wrong, but it doesnt seem so. I'm using the interrupt #61 (I tried also with the 0x3D hexa value.. though I do not see the difference).
